Find the best trading platforms for UK traders in 2025

Welcome to Tradingplatforms.co.uk, your trusted resource for finding FCA-regulated online brokers serving UK traders. Explore in-depth reviews of forex, stock, commodity, and CFD brokers, along with unbiased rankings and detailed comparisons. We also offer practical trading calculators and expert guides to help you sharpen your skills and deepen your market knowledge.

Compare the Top UK Trading Platforms

FeatureMetaTrader 5 (MT5)TradingViewcTrader
Platform vendorMetaQuotes (offshore, software vendor only)TradingView Inc. (US-based data/tech provider)Spotware Systems (Cyprus-based software vendor)
Official websitemetatrader5.comtradingview.comctrader.com
App Store link
Google Play link
Primary use caseBroker-connected trading + algorithmic systemsCharting, analysis, social sharing, broker/APIBroker-connected trading + algorithmic systems
Platform typeDesktop app (Windows/macOS), web, mobileWeb-based platform, desktop app, mobile appsDesktop app (Windows), web, mobile apps
Typical asset classesForex, CFDs, indices, commodities, some stocksForex, CFDs, stocks, cryptoForex, CFDs, indices, commodities, some shares/ETFs
Execution modelmarket/ECN/STP/dealing deskExecution via connected brokersFocus on ECN/STP style execution
Order typesMarket, limit, stop, stop-limit, trailing stopMarket, limit, stop, stop-limit Market, limit, stop, stop-limit, trailing stop, server-side protection
Depth of market (DOM)Available, but varies by broker/liquidityBasic L2/DOM with some brokersAdvanced DOM with price ladder and volume info
Charting qualityGood, traditional; many chart types/timeframesVery strong, multi-timeframe, multi-layoutStrong, modern charts; less flexible than TradingView but cleaner than MT5
Supported timeframesFrom tick to monthly (21+ presets)From seconds to monthlyFrom tick to monthly with multiple presets
Indicators – built-in80+ built-in technical indicators100+ built-in indicators~60+ built-in indicators
Indicators – customCustom via MQL5Custom via Pine ScriptCustom via cAlgo (C#); growing but smaller ecosystem than MT5
Drawing toolsStandard set: trendlines, fibs, channels, etc.Very rich set: fibs, pitchforks, patterns, notesGood set of drawing tools, slightly fewer than TradingView
Multi-asset watchlistsYes, with symbol groups and custom listsVery flexible watchlistsWatchlists with grouping, symbol linking to charts
Multi-chart layoutsMultiple charts in one workspaceHighly flexible grid layoutsMultiple undockable charts, profiles and layouts
Custom scripts / algorithmsMQL5 (proprietary C-like language)Pine Script (proprietary, designed for indicators/strategies)C# via cAlgo / cTrader Automate
Ease of codingModerate; more complex but powerfulDesigned for traders first; easy learning curveUses C#; very powerful but requires programming background
Algorithmic tradingNative, integrated in terminal (EAs and scripts)Strategy backtesting on charts; auto-trading only via broker/APINative automated trading with cBots integrated in platform
BacktestingRobust; single and multi-symbol, multi-threadedOn-chart backtesting for strategiesRobust tick-based backtesting with visual results
Optimisation of strategiesYes, with genetic algorithms and parameter sweepsLimited parameter optimisation in PineYes, optimisation for cBots with parameter sweeps
Market / app storeVery large Marketplace (indicators, EAs, signals)Public scripts library + paid indicatorscTrader store is smaller but has third-party cBots/indicators
Copy / social tradingBuilt-in signal service; many third-party providersStrong social layer: idea publishing, comments, scriptscCopy / built-in copy trading plus some third-party services
News and economic calendarIntegrated news and calendar (depends on broker feeds)Built-in economic calendar and news widgetsBuilt-in news/calendar (depends on broker integration)
Broker integrationVery wide; almost all MT5 brokersLimited list of direct brokers + integrations via APIs/bridgesGrowing but smaller list than MT5; focused on ECN/STP brokers
Order management toolsOne-click trading, partial closes, multiple TPsWeb order tickets, bracket ordersOne-click trading, advanced TPs, SL in pips/money
Risk management toolsSL/TP, trailing stops, margin monitoringSL/TP, alerts, position size tools via scriptsSL/TP, advanced order protection, built-in volume and risk controls
AlertsPrice, indicator, and trading alerts (terminal-based)Very flexible alerts (price, indicator, drawing object)Price and trade alerts
UI/UX styleOlder, more utilitarian; extremely familiar in forexModern, web-first, highly polished user experienceModern, clean, intuitive; feels more like a pro trading terminal
Performance on many chartsCan become heavy with many charts/EAsBrowser-dependent; can be heavy with many layoutsGenerally smooth; depends on hardware and broker feed
Mobile appsiOS/Android apps for trading and basic chartsiOS/Android apps with strong charting and alertsiOS/Android apps; good for order management and charts
Offline useDesktop can run without internet for testing/backtestsRequires internet (cloud-based)Desktop can run locally for backtesting; live trading needs connection
Pricing / licensingPlatform free via brokers; pay only for add-ons/EAsFree tier with ads/limits; paid Pro plans for more chartsFree via supported brokers; pay only for third-party add-ons
Data sourcesBroker’s data feed onlyMultiple data vendors/exchangesBroker’s data feed only
DOM / scalping suitabilityReasonable for scalping; depends on broker latencyLess used for high-frequency scalping; more for analysisVery good for scalping, with fast DOM and hotkeys
Hedging and nettingSupports both hedging and netting modesDepends on broker/account via integrationSupports hedging; designed with multi-position control
Best strengthsHuge broker support, massive algo ecosystem, deep backtestingElite charting, social community, best for multi-asset analysisGreat execution tools, clean UI, strong algo via C#,
Main limitationsDated interface; proprietary language; broker-locked dataNot a broker; actual execution depends on third-party brokers/APIs and plan limitsSmaller ecosystem and broker list than MT5
Best suited forTraders who want wide broker choice, EAs, and deep algo/backtest toolsTraders who prioritise charting, idea sharingActive forex/CFD traders wanting ECN-style execution

Compare the 15 Best Forex Brokers in the UK

Read our comprehensive reviews of various FCA-regulated forex brokers to learn more about their commissions, spreads, non-trading fees, and supported deposit methods. We also provide extensive information about each broker’s product lineup, available trading platforms, and other vital aspects required for fully informed decision-making when selecting a trusted forex trading site in the UK.

Forex Brokers Comparison

Browse the 12 Best CFD Brokers for UK Traders

All CFD brokers on our list hold licences by the FCA and comply with local regulatory requirements, including imposing retail leverage caps and offering negative balance protection to non-professional traders. The recommended brokers deliver competitive CFD trading conditions, such as tight spreads, low commissions, and transparent swap fees on overnight leveraged positions.

CFD Brokers Comparison

Find the Top 10 Crypto Exchanges in the UK

Our reviewers evaluate UK-friendly crypto exchanges based on several crucial factors, including compliance with FCA regulatory requirements, security measures, range of available cryptocurrencies, maker/taker fees, staking rewards, overall user experience, and more.

Crypto Exchanges Comparison

Compare the Top 12 Stock Brokers in the UK

Find the best FCA-licensed brokers for trading and investing in domestic or international stocks where you will benefit from low commissions, competitive dividend payment structures, and transparent pricing.

Stock Brokers Comparison